The common cold is a coronavirus. There's also a few other strains of coronavirus, one of which is pretty lethal for older people. Covid-19 is a new coronavirus. It is new. To say covid-19 isn't new because the common cold is a coronavirus too is like saying a cold sore and genital herpes are the same since they're both herpesvirus. Covid-19, or SARS-Cov-2, is more closely related to SARS than the common cold and we can all be massively relieved it isn't as lethal. Though SARS wasn't nearly as infectious.
